Output e3d60ab951060d4d39673ee99837e80c912510c032843911b2d025a04c3474b9:7

value
1827990
script pubkey
OP_0 OP_PUSHBYTES_20 908da54f6077f1b9d721095b1aedb9f4e985a705
address
bc1qjzx62nmqwlcmn4epp9d34mde7n5ctfc9sz8kc7
transaction
e3d60ab951060d4d39673ee99837e80c912510c032843911b2d025a04c3474b9
spent
true